Abstract

The invention discloses an auxiliary installation device of an intelligent temperature controller, which comprises a shell, clapboards, a controller, a fixed pipe, an air inlet box, an air outlet box, fixed blocks, a screen, a button, a switch and a socket, wherein the clapboard is fixedly connected inside the shell, the controller is clamped outside the shell, the fixed pipe is fixedly connected inside the shell, the air inlet box is fixedly sleeved inside one of the clapboards, the air outlet box is fixedly sleeved inside the other clapboard, the fixed block is fixedly connected outside the shell, the screen is fixedly connected outside the controller, the button is arranged on the controller, the switch is arranged on the controller, and the socket is fixedly connected outside the controller. The invention relates to an auxiliary installation device of an intelligent temperature controller, which has the characteristics of convenience in disassembly and maintenance and convenience in heat dissipation of the temperature controller after installation.

Technical Field
The invention belongs to the technical field of intelligent temperature controllers, and particularly relates to an auxiliary installation device of an intelligent temperature controller.
Background
An intelligent temperature controller is a device for controlling temperature. Air conditioner, water heater, central new trend system, light etc. warms up can be controlled to the intelligent temperature controller on the present market, when installing intelligent temperature controller, need install the inside at the wall body earlier with supplementary installation device, then install the inside at supplementary installation device with intelligent temperature controller, but there are some problems in supplementary installation device at present: 1. the mounted intelligent temperature controller is inconvenient to disassemble and maintain; 2. the auxiliary installation device is installed in the wall, so that the heat dissipation effect of the intelligent temperature controller is affected, the heat of the inner side component of the intelligent temperature controller is not dissipated, the service life of the intelligent temperature controller is affected, and therefore the auxiliary installation device of the intelligent temperature controller needs to be designed.

The invention has the beneficial effects that: the invention relates to an auxiliary installation device of an intelligent temperature controller, which has the characteristics of convenient disassembly and maintenance after installation and convenient heat dissipation of the temperature controller, and compared with the traditional auxiliary installation device of the intelligent temperature controller, the auxiliary installation device of the intelligent temperature controller has the following two beneficial effects in specific use:
firstly, structures such as a fixed block, a clamping block and a spring are additionally arranged on the outer side of a shell, the controller is changed into a clamping type by originally mounting the clamping block on the controller through screws, and when the controller needs to be overhauled, the clamping block can be moved out of a clamping groove, so that the control can be disassembled;
secondly, through adding the structures such as establishing air inlet box, play bellows and heating panel in the inside of casing, can make the inside hot-air of casing discharge through the play bellows, cold air enters into the inside of casing from the air inlet box, dispels the heat to the controller for the inside heat of control can not gather, makes the life extension of controller.
